Back in March, the world celebrated Earth Hour by turning off lights all around the globe for sixty minutes. Actor Adrian Grenier, however, recreates such activism anytime he has friends over.
“We turn of all the electricity in the house and go off grid. We enjoy each other’s company without distractions from the radio or cellphones,” he recently mentioned. According to the source, Grenier does it because he believes its the best way for him to conserve energy. We also think he wants to get the most out of those solar panels on his Brooklyn roof.
When asked if the set of his hit HBO show Entourage might see some greening, Adrian said, “I will make sure of it… (But) not everyone wants to embrace being environmentally friendly.”
Good luck — and tell Vince to drop the Hummer.
